What Is CBD and How Does It Work?

CBD is a chemical compound derived from the hemp plant. Unlike THC, CBD is non-psychoactive, meaning it doesn’t cause the high associated with marijuana. It interacts with the body’s endocannabinoid system (ECS), which helps regulate functions like pain, mood, and sleep. By binding to receptors in the ECS, particularly CB1 and CB2 receptors, CBD helps reduce pain and inflammation, making it a powerful tool for pain management.

This interaction is why CBD has gained attention for its potential to relieve a variety of pain types, offering a natural alternative to traditional pain relief methods.

CBD can be effective for several types of pain. The most common types of pain that may benefit from CBD use include chronic pain, neuropathic pain, inflammatory pain, and acute pain.

Chronic Pain

Chronic pain persists for months or even years and can result from conditions like arthritis, back pain, and fibromyalgia. CBD is particularly helpful for managing chronic pain because of its ability to reduce inflammation and modulate pain signals. Many users report that cannabidiol for pain helps improve their quality of life by reducing long-term pain.

Neuropathic Pain

Neuropathic pain is caused by nerve damage and can result in sharp, burning sensations. Conditions like diabetes and spinal cord injuries often lead to neuropathic pain. Research suggests that CBD can help manage this type of pain by altering how the nervous system processes pain signals, providing relief from nerve-related discomfort.

Inflammatory Pain

Inflammation is a common cause of pain, especially in conditions like arthritis or sports injuries. CBD’s anti-inflammatory properties are well-documented. By reducing inflammation, CBD helps alleviate pain caused by conditions like rheumatoid arthritis and other inflammatory disorders.

Acute Pain

Acute pain is short-term pain that occurs after an injury or surgery. While temporary, acute pain can be intense and disruptive. CBD helps manage acute pain by reducing swelling and providing localized relief. CBD oil for pain is often applied topically or taken orally for fast relief from sore muscles and joint pain.

Scientific Research and Studies on CBD for Pain

Numerous studies have explored CBD’s effectiveness for pain management. A 2018 review published in Frontiers in Pharmacology found that CBD significantly reduced pain and inflammation in conditions like arthritis, multiple sclerosis, and chronic pain. Other research has shown that CBD helps reduce neuropathic pain and pain associated with inflammation. The body of research continues to grow, and evidence suggests that CBD is a promising option for those seeking natural CBD pain relief.

As more studies emerge, the scientific community continues to examine ‘how does CBD help with pain’. Early findings have been positive, indicating that CBD’s an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ties make it a valuable tool in pain management.

Best CBD Products for Pain Relief

If you’re considering using CBD for pain relief, there are several types of products to choose from. Each type of product has its own advantages depending on your needs and preferences.

CBD Oil/Tinctures

CBD oil for pain is one of the most common and effective ways to manage pain. Tinctures are absorbed quickly when placed under the tongue, allowing for fast relief. The best CBD for pain often comes in the form of high-quality oils and tinctures, which offer quick absorption and consistent effects.

Topicals (Creams, Balms, Patches)

For targeted relief, CBD topicals such as creams, balms, and patches are a great option. These products are applied directly to the skin and absorbed into the underlying tissues, making them effective for sore muscles, joint pain, or skin inflammation. They also provide cannabidiol for pain in a convenient, localized form, offering fast relief without the need to ingest CBD.

Edibles & Capsules

CBD edibles and capsules provide a convenient, discreet way to consume CBD. They take longer to take effect than tinctures, as they must be digested, but they provide long-lasting relief. These products are ideal for people who need consistent pain management throughout the day.

Vaping/Smoking CBD

Vaping offers fast relief by allowing CBD to enter the bloodstream immediately. However, vaping may not be suitable for everyone, particularly those with respiratory issues. If you choose this method, ensure you’re using high-quality CBD vape products to avoid harmful additives.

How to Use CBD for Pain Relief

When using CBD for pain relief, start with a low dose and gradually increase it until you find the optimal dosage for your needs. For chronic pain, tinctures and edibles may provide the best relief, while topicals are ideal for localized discomfort. Vaping is effective for immediate relief, but it’s important to be mindful of potential respiratory risks.

Consult with a healthcare professional before starting CBD, especially if you’re on other medications or have preexisting health conditions.

Choosing Quality CBD Products

It’s essential to choose high-quality CBD products to ensure safety and effectiveness. Look for products that are third-party tested, meaning they have been independently verified for potency and purity. Full-spectrum CBD products are generally preferred, as they contain a range of beneficial compounds that work together for enhanced effects. Additionally, ensure the products are free from harmful additives, especially if you’re using CBD skincare or cannabidiol cosmetics.
